SUMMARY:
Some AOO dialogs provide adjustable columns with column dividers marked by thin gray lines. One can resize a column by holding the mouse button down on the divider and dragging it to the desired location. If column divider is moved outside the right border, the column and its divider may disappear.
Some dialogs prevent this from happening (see point 1.). In other cases, in order to bring the default layout back, one has to re-invoke
the dialog (see point 2.1.) or even go to extremes and reset
the User Profile (see point 2.2.).

(The attached file "Columns" contains relevant screenshots).


1. Acceptable design
Examples:
- 'Tools > Customize > Events tab'
- Basic IDE, assigning macros to program events - "Assign action" dialog

Consider 'Tools > Customize > Events tab', two columns named:
"Event" and "Assigned Action".
Move the column divider to the right outside the border. Notice that AOO prevents hidding the column completely, thus it's easy to regain
"hidden" column.


2. Incorrect design

2.1. "Reversible" - easy way

Examples of dialogs:
- in AOO Calc: 'Tools > Share Document', "Share Document" dialog
- 'File > Digital Signatures', "Digital Signatures" dialog
- 'File > Digital Signatures > Sign Document',
  "Select Certificate" dialog

Consider 'File > Digital Signatures', "Digital Signatures" dialog.
Four columns, three named: "Signed by", "Digital ID issued by" and "Date".
Move the last column divider to the right outside the border.
Column is hidden. Repeat that operation for the columns: "Signed by" and "Digital ID issued by". You end up with one column.

To go back to the default layout, close the dialog and reopen it.
All columns are displayed again.


2.2. "Reversible" - an unsual way

Open and Save dialog boxes fall in this category.
(in 'Tools > Options > OpenOffice >  General'
 in the Open/Save dialogs area select "Use OpenOffice dialogs")

Consider 'File > Open', "Open" dialog
Move in turn column divider for columns: "Date modified", "Size" and "Type". You end up with one column "Name".

No obvious way to bring the hidden columns back, as with point 2.1.
Deselecting and selecting "OpenOffice dialogs" won't help and one has
to reset the User Profile to fix the problem ("going to extremes").


-----------------------------------------------------------------------

Notes:

1. Expected behaviour - all dialogs with adjustable columns shall behave 
   like those mentioned in point 1. above. (other acceptable solution
   could be one used e.g. in Windows Registry Editor).

2. Issue observed in AOO 4.1.7 too.
